Quote:
Originally Posted by scoopy258 View Post
Opp fire EMS.
OPP--the 15X is not able to decode digital so unless you are in Simcoe near the Beat Repeater you are out of luck. You will only get a bit of local stuff off the Beat Repeater.

Fire--looks like you should be good from what I see in the database

EMS--the 15X will be great for Fleetnet and listening to EMS and MTO Maintenance
